Le Cowboy is a high-volatility Western slot from Hacksaw Gaming released in 2025. Built on a cluster pays grid (size not specified but looks like 6x6 or 7x7), this game centers on cascading wins, Revolver Cylinders that shoot symbols to reveal special prizes, and a complex chain reaction system with Coins, Diamonds, Clovers, and Loot Bags. RTP wasn't provided but Hacksaw typically offers 96%+ default. With cluster pays requiring 5+ matching symbols and multiple bonus levels, this is one of Hacksaw's more complex releases.
I played this for multiple sessions and honestly, it took a while to understand what was even happening. The Revolver Reveal feature is the core mechanic. When a wild is part of a winning cluster, it transforms into a Revolver Cylinder with 2-6 shots. The cylinder fires at random positions revealing Coins, Diamonds, Clovers, Loot Bags, and Reload symbols. Then those symbols activate in order with multipliers and collections happening. It's chaotic but satisfying when everything chains together.
Landing 3-5 FS symbols triggers three different bonus levels: High Noon Saloon (3 FS), Trail of Trickery (4 FS), or the hidden Pistols at Dawn (5 FS). Each level adds mechanics. You can also gamble bonuses to upgrade or win instant cash prizes.

Features:
Super Cascades: When clusters win, ALL symbols of that type (not just the cluster) get removed and new symbols cascade down. Creates bigger chains than standard cascades.
In practice, this means if you get a 7-symbol Cowboy cluster win, every Cowboy on the entire grid disappears. I had cascades chain 5-6 times because of this mechanic clearing huge portions of the grid.
Revolver Reveal: When a wild is part of a winning cluster, it transforms into a Revolver Cylinder with 2-6 shots. After cascades settle, cylinders fire at random grid positions revealing special symbols:
- Coins: Bronze (1x-4x), Silver (5x-20x), Gold (25x-100x)
- Diamonds: 150x, 250x, 500x
- Green Clovers: Multiply adjacent prizes by x2, x3, x4, x5, x10, x20
- Gold Clovers: Multiply ALL prizes on grid by x2, x3, x4, x5, x10, x20
- Loot Bags: Collect all Coin/Diamond/Loot Bag values and store them
- Reload: Reloads all cylinders with 2-6 new shots, process repeats
If a Coin gets shot again, it upgrades to next tier. If a Green Clover gets shot again, it becomes a Gold Clover (multiplying everything instead of just adjacent). Only one Reload can appear at a time.
The activation order is: Cylinders shoot → Coins/Diamonds reveal values → Clovers multiply → Loot Bags collect → If Reload appeared, repeat entire process.
This is where the slot gets complex. I had rounds with 2 Reloads triggering back-to-back. Cylinders fired 18 total shots across 3 cycles. Clovers multiplied prizes multiple times. Loot Bags collected escalating values. That spin paid 680x from a 20x bet.
High Noon Saloon Bonus (3 FS): Triggered by 3 FS symbols. Awards 10 free spins with increased Revolver Cylinder frequency. Retriggers with +2 (2 FS) or +4 (3 FS) additional spins.
When triggered, you get a Bonus Gamble choice: play the bonus OR gamble for upgrade/cash prizes. Gambling shoots a revolver with 4 outcomes:
- Upgrade to Trail of Trickery
- Instant 1x-4x cash
- Instant 5x-20x cash
- Instant 25x-100x cash
I triggered this 4 times. Played it twice (paid 85x and 210x). Gambled twice (won Trail upgrade once, lost and got 10x cash once).
Trail of Trickery Bonus (4 FS): Triggered by 4 FS symbols. Awards 10 free spins with High Noon mechanics PLUS a Bullet Collector that adds +1 bullet per win. On the final spin, Smokey fires all collected bullets at the grid revealing Coin/Diamond/Clover/Loot Bag symbols. Then normal Revolver Reveal continues.
Gambling offers 8 outcomes:
- Upgrade to Pistols at Dawn 2-3. Instant 5x-20x cash (two slots) 4-7. Instant 25x-100x cash (four slots)
- Instant 150x-500x cash
I triggered this once naturally. Collected 14 bullets across 10 spins. Final spin Smokey shot 14 positions, revealed 8 Coins, 4 Clovers, 2 Loot Bags. Then cylinders fired, Reloads triggered twice. Total payout was 1,240x. Best bonus I hit.
Pistols at Dawn (5 FS - Hidden Epic): Triggered by 5 FS symbols. Awards 10 free spins with Trail mechanics PLUS the Bullet Collector starts at 5 bullets and triggers EVERY spin (not just last). After triggering, it resets to its last value and keeps collecting. Silver Coins (5x-20x) are the minimum that can land. No FS symbols can appear.
I never triggered this naturally in my sessions. Based on mechanics, it should absolutely destroy with bullets firing every spin plus continuous Revolver Cylinders.

🎯 What I Learned Playing It
The Revolver System Is Brilliant But Confusing
First 30 spins I had no idea what was happening. Cylinders shot, symbols appeared, things multiplied, values collected. It felt random. After 100+ spins I started understanding the flow: cylinders shoot → values reveal → clovers multiply → loot bags collect → reload repeats.
Once it clicked, I appreciated the depth. But new players will be completely lost.
Reload Symbols Are Game Changers
When a Reload appeared, my heart rate spiked. One Reload means cylinders fire again, potentially revealing more Reloads. I had a chain where 3 Reloads triggered consecutively. The spin resolution took over a minute. Paid 580x from a base 15x cluster win.
Without Reloads, most Revolver Reveals paid 10x-50x. With 1-2 Reloads, suddenly you're at 150x-500x+. The entire game revolves around hoping Reloads appear.
Gold Clovers Are Broken
Green Clovers multiplying adjacent prizes are fine. Gold Clovers multiplying EVERYTHING on the grid are insane. I had a Gold Clover with x10 land when there were 6 Coins (total 85x value) and 2 Loot Bags (total 120x value) on grid. Everything got multiplied by x10. Instant 2,050x payout.
Gold Clovers are rare. I saw maybe 5 across 400+ spins. But when they land with good Coin/Loot Bag coverage, they print money.
Coin Upgrades Feel Satisfying
Watching a Bronze Coin (2x) get shot by a cylinder and upgrade to Silver (10x), then get shot again and upgrade to Gold (75x) is incredibly satisfying. The visual feedback and escalating values create genuine excitement.
But it requires cylinders landing, then shooting the same position multiple times, which is rare. Most Coins stay Bronze.
Super Cascades Clear Too Much
The mechanic where ALL matching symbols disappear (not just the cluster) is aggressive. I'd land a 6-symbol Horseshoe cluster, and 12 total Horseshoes would vanish from the grid. This creates big cascades but also removes potential future clusters.
Sometimes this helped by clearing the board for better symbols. Other times it killed momentum by removing symbols that could've formed secondary clusters.
Base Game Can Be Dead
I had stretches of 40-50 spins with only small card symbol clusters paying 0.5x-3x. No wilds landing means no Revolver Cylinders. No cylinders means no special symbols. Just grinding tiny clusters.
The game needs wilds to activate its mechanics. When wilds ghost you for 30+ spins, it's boring.
High Noon Saloon Is Hit or Miss
My two High Noon rounds:
- First paid 85x over 10 spins. Cylinders appeared 4 times total. Mostly Bronze Coins, one Reload. Underwhelming.
- Second paid 210x with one retrigger (14 total spins). Cylinders appeared 8 times. Two Reloads chained. Better but not amazing.
High Noon feels like the baseline bonus. It's fine but not exciting compared to Trail of Trickery.
Trail of Trickery Delivered
The Bullet Collector mechanic makes Trail way better than High Noon. I collected 14 bullets across 10 spins (one bullet per win). Final spin Smokey fired all 14 at once.
That barrage revealed 8 Coins, 4 Clovers, 2 Loot Bags. Then existing cylinders fired. Then Reloads triggered twice. The entire resolution took 90+ seconds. Paid 1,240x total.
Trail feels like where the game's potential lives. High Noon is the consolation prize.
Bonus Gambling Is Tempting But Dangerous
I gambled High Noon twice:
- First attempt: Won, upgraded to Trail of Trickery. Felt like a genius.
- Second attempt: Lost, got 10x cash prize. Bonus ended immediately. Felt terrible.
The gambling odds aren't transparent. You're shooting blind (literally). Winning the upgrade feels amazing. Losing and getting 10x-25x cash after waiting 100+ spins for the trigger feels awful.
The Complexity Is A Double-Edged Sword
I appreciate that Hacksaw tried something different. The Revolver system with chaining Reloads and multi-step activations is creative. When it fires on all cylinders (pun intended), it's spectacular.
But it's also exhausting to follow. Casual players will be confused. Even after several sessions, I still lost track of what was happening during intense Reload chains.
Budget Heavy
Extreme volatility (assumed) means brutal bankroll swings. I played 300 spins at $0.50 bet ($150 total). Triggered High Noon twice, Trail once. Ended +$420 ($270 profit) entirely because of that one 1,240x Trail round.
Without that Trail hit, I'd have been down $80. One bonus can make or break your entire session.

Verdict
Le Cowboy is Hacksaw Gaming at their most ambitious. The Revolver Reveal system with chaining Reloads, upgrading Coins, multiplying Clovers, and collecting Loot Bags is genuinely creative. When everything aligns (multiple cylinders, Reloads chaining, Gold Clovers landing, Loot Bags collecting escalating values), it's spectacular. Trail of Trickery with the Bullet Collector firing on the final spin plus continuous cylinders can deliver 1,000x-2,000x+ payouts.
The Super Cascades removing all matching symbols creates bigger chains than typical cluster slots. The three bonus tiers (High Noon, Trail, Pistols at Dawn) with gambling options add strategic choice. The Western theme with Smokey shooting cylinders is well-executed with quality animations.
But the complexity is overwhelming. New players won't understand what's happening. The base game without wilds feels dead. High Noon Saloon (the most common bonus) is underwhelming. Bonus gambling can backfire brutally. The extreme volatility (assumed) demands massive bankroll.
Play if: you enjoy complex Hacksaw mechanics, have serious bankroll (300x+ bet), appreciate creative systems over simplicity, and want potential for massive chain reaction wins.
Skip if: you want straightforward gameplay, have limited bankroll, get frustrated by dead base game stretches, or prefer consistent bonuses over high-risk gambling.
I'd rate it 7.5/10. It's creative and exciting when it works but exhausting to follow and punishing when it doesn't. The Trail of Trickery bonus alone makes it worth trying in demo. If the complexity doesn't scare you off after 200 demo spins, you might love this. Just bring patience and deep pockets.
